The word ‘influence’ typically refers to the kind of effect or impression one can have on another person that may influence his or her consequent choices. Be it about buying something or checking out new experiences, in today’s world, people seek recommendations or reviews from those whom they have come to believe in order to make their own decisions. And that is what forms the fundamental crux of influencer marketing. Influencer marketing can be described as a form of ‘social media marketing involving endorsements, and product placement from influencers, people, and organizations who have a purported expert level of knowledge or social influence in their field. Influencers are someone with the power to affect the buying habits or quantifiable actions of others by uploading some form of original, often sponsored, content to social media platforms like Instagram, YouTube, Snapchat, or other online channels.

We all have heard about social media influencers like the much-talented Bruised Passport, Prajakta Koli, etc. When they talk about a certain product or service in their own channels, it is easier for the brand to able to reach out to a wider scope of the audience who might even turn into potential customers, after being influenced by their reviews or recommendations. This is especially important in the case of the service industry, like hotels. In hotels, the product is not tangible. Rather it is experiential and cannot be duplicated. It is unique to each guest. The standards may remain the same. However, the stay experience may be different for each guest. In such a scenario, influencer marketing allows the hotels to be able to showcase their best service scape to the guest and reach out to a larger section of the audience through their influence.

According to industry veteran and Hotel Manager of The Westin Pushkar Resort and Spa, Mr. Gaurav Sekhri, “Influencer marketing is one of the most essential parts of the hotel marketing paradigms. This is because not only does it help us to reach more probable customers through the influencers but also be able to recognize the strength in our own service moments, realize what more we can do for our guests, and ultimately be able to add to the marketing and brand value of the property. Influencer marketing helps us in adding to our brand persona and value. As a luxury resort, we always look forth to hosting influencers from the diverse scapes of lifestyle, hospitality, and travel to indulge in our experience and be able to share them with their audience”.
